Tamara Shrader, ACNP

Tammie was raised in Flagstaff, AZ, and graduated with degrees in Biological Science from Colorado State University, Bachelor of Nursing from Idaho State University, and Master of Nursing Science from St. Louis University. Her interest in medicine started at an early age, from Candy-striper in the ER to Intermediate EMT.

Board certified as an Adult Gerontological Acute Care Nurse Practitioner (AGACNP) through the American Nurses Credentialing Center (ANCC), she has also worked many years as an ICU travel nurse, initially learning those skills at Alaska Native Medical Center.

She started her Alaskan journey working at a fish cannery/cold storage and in logging camps, eventually making her way to the back deck of a fishing boat. Commercial fishing remained a livelihood for many years, from San Francisco Bay to Togiak, AK.
